Baldwin Insurance Group (NASDAQ:BWIN – Get Free Report) had its price objective raised by equities research analysts at Wells Fargo & Company from $25.00 to $27.00 in a research note issued to investors on Tuesday,Benzinga reports. The brokerage presently has an “equal weight” rating on the stock. Wells Fargo & Company‘s target price points to a potential upside of 1.54% from the company’s current price.
A number of other equities research analysts also recently commented on BWIN. JPMorgan Chase & Co. lowered their price objective on Baldwin Insurance Group from $33.00 to $28.00 and set a “neutral” rating for the company in a research report on Wednesday, January 7th. BMO Capital Markets lowered their price target on Baldwin Insurance Group from $34.00 to $33.00 and set a “market perform” rating for the company in a report on Thursday, December 4th. Wall Street Zen lowered Baldwin Insurance Group from a “hold” rating to a “sell” rating in a research report on Friday, October 3rd. Weiss Ratings reaffirmed a “sell (e+)” rating on shares of Baldwin Insurance Group in a research report on Monday, December 29th. Finally, UBS Group lowered their price target on Baldwin Insurance Group from $52.00 to $47.00 and set a “buy” rating for the company in a report on Monday, November 10th. Two equities research analysts have rated the stock with a Buy rating, five have given a Hold rating and one has given a Sell rating to the company’s stock. According to MarketBeat.com, the stock presently has a consensus rating of “Hold” and an average price target of $33.83.

Baldwin Insurance Group Stock Performance
Baldwin Insurance Group (NASDAQ:BWIN – Get Free Report) last released its earnings results on Tuesday, November 4th. The company reported $0.31 EPS for the quarter, hitting the consensus estimate of $0.31. The firm had revenue of $365.39 million during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$364.14 million. Baldwin Insurance Group had a negative net margin of 1.89% and a positive return on equity of 12.65%. Baldwin Insurance Group’s revenue for the quarter was up 7.5%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period in the previous year, the company earned $0.33 EPS. On average, sell-side analysts predict that Baldwin Insurance Group will post 1.01 EPS for the current year.
Insiders Place Their Bets
In other news, insider James Morgan Roche sold 100,000 shares of the firm’s stock in a transaction dated Friday, December 12th. The stock was sold at an average price of $24.20, for a total transaction of $2,420,000.00. Following the completion of the sale, the insider directly owned 122,113 shares in the company, valued at $2,955,134.60. This trade represents a 45.02%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The sale was disclosed in a legal fil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is available at this hyperlink. Over the last three months, insiders have sold 255,000 shares of company stock valued at $6,119,000. Corporate insiders own 18.51% of the company’s stock.

Baldwin Insurance Group Company Profile
Baldwin Insurance Group, Inc (NASDAQ: BWIN) is a specialty insurance and surety firm that underwrites contract bonds, commercial insurance policies and related risk-management services. Its core offerings include contract and commercial surety, which provide performance and payment guarantees to obligees in construction, service and public-sector projects. In addition, the company delivers complementary commercial lines coverages designed to mitigate liability, property and workers’ compensation exposures.
Through a network of regional agency offices primarily across the Midwestern United States, Baldwin Insurance Group serves contractors, developers, small and mid-sized businesses as well as municipal and public-sector clients.
